正文
vb.net变量入门 vb变量怎么定义
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
vb.net 定义变量 ,类型,对象问题?
在.NET中vb.net变量入门,对象和结构还是有些不同vb.net变量入门的vb.net变量入门,定义方式也是其中之一。
像整型、字符串和一些数值类型都属于结构。结构只需要这样定义就可以vb.net变量入门了:
Dim str As String
系统自动分配内存vb.net变量入门,然后就可以对它进行访问了。
如果像这样声明普通类:
Dim cla As Class
此时直接访问cla类成员会引发一个null异常。因为你仅仅声明了cla的类型(cla是Class类型的),而内存中没有一个真正的对象(类的实例)。如果你需要一个实例,就需要用New关键字,例如:
Dim cla As New Class("some words")
这时系统会建立一个Class对象,并将cla指向这个对象。这样就完成了一次实例化。这时就可以直接访问cla的成员了。
在实例化时,系统会调用对象的New函数,即构造函数。后面括号里的内容并不是对象的属性,而是要传递给这个构造函数的参数。至于对象的构造函数是否需要参数、需要多少参数以、参数的类型及重载情况等,取决于要实例化的类型。
上面的Class只是例子,代换成实际的类即可。
VB新手怎么才能入门?入门有哪些技巧?对英文我一点都不懂!应该怎么办,我也记不住那些英文。高手指点!
有中文版本vb.net变量入门的vb.net变量入门,对英文要求不是很高vb.net变量入门,只是说英文好的话可以更好的理解vb.net变量入门,事实上要记的英文没几个,大多数都是自己或系统定义的变量,这里面更重要的是数学——数学才是编程的灵魂。VB是一种面向对象编程语言,是高级语言的一种,很容易的,可以自学
VB.NET定义变量
Imports ESRI.ArcGIS.Geodatabase
加在文件vb.net变量入门的开头vb.net变量入门,这样就会把IFeature 自动识别为ESRI.ArcGIS.Geodatabase.IFeaturevb.net变量入门了。
ESRI.ArcGIS.Geodatabase是一个命名空间vb.net变量入门,里面有一个叫IFeaturevb.net变量入门的类,ESRI.ArcGIS.Geodatabase.IFeature就是指这个类。如果你只写IFeature的话,编译系统就会认为你要用当前命名空间里的IFeature类,但它找不到这个叫IFeature的类,所以就会报错。
Imports就有这个功能,只写一遍命名空间名称,以后不用写命名空间名称就可以直接使用里面的各种类、常量、变量等等。
VB.net的静态变量怎么定义
在asp.net中应用静态变量要比application更好的选择
在传统的asp页面中,我们需要利用application变量传递一些特殊变量,在asp.net中任何页面都可以是类,,Global.asax也不例外。
我们只需要在Global.asax加入类名。
%@ Application Classname="MyGlobals" %
然后我们定义几个静态变量。
在vb.net中应用shared
在C#中应用static
VB:
Script language="vb" runat="server"
Public Shared sGreeting as String = "welcome"
/Script
C#
Script language="C#" runat="server"
Public Static String sGreeting = "welcome"
/Script
现在我们在其他的asp.net叶面就可以应用类名.变量名就可以在引用他了。
x = MyGlobals.sGreeti
新手求教:VB.net中有没有引用型的变量
当然有啊,
引用类型的变量就是类的实例化对象
VB.net值类型包括14种基本数据类型(除String)、结构和枚举,其他都是引用类型
引用一个按钮对象
Dim a As Button = Button1 '假设窗体中有Button1这个按钮控件
引用一个自定义类的对象
Public Class Class1
End Class
Dim b As New Class1
上面的a和b都是引用型的变量。
字符串也是引用型的变量
它是基础数据类型中唯一的引用型数据类型。
Dim s As String = "字符串也是引用类型!"
满意请采纳,谢谢。
vb.net中的变量如何使用?
VB.NET中的变量在使用前要进行声明。即便不进行显式声明vb.net变量入门,VB也会进行隐式声明。
本题中应该这样使用:
Dim a1 As String = TextBox1.Text
System.Diagnostics.Process.Start("IExplore.exe", a1)
变量是存储值的名称。可使用变量来存储数字vb.net变量入门,例如建筑物的高度vb.net变量入门,或者存储单词,例如人的名字。简单地说,可使用变量表示程序所需的任何信息。
你可能会问:“既然我可以使用信息,为什么要用变量?” 正如其名称所表示的,变量可以随着程序的运行而改变其表示的值。例如,您可以写一个程序来跟踪桌子上罐里的软心豆粒糖的数目。因为糖是要被吃掉的,所以罐里软心豆粒糖的数目可能会随着时间的推移而改变。您可以使用一个可随时间变化的变量来表示软心豆粒糖的数目,而无需在每次想吃糖时重新编写程序。
关于vb.net变量入门和vb变量怎么定义的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。